MEN'S GOLF
Monday-Tuesday, April 13-14 / Lewis Chitengwa Memorial / Charlottesville, Va. /Â Live Scoring
Saturday, April 18 / at Hoosier Collegiate Invitational / Bloomington, Ind. / Live Scoring
Men's Golf wraps up its regular season with a pair of tournaments this week. Toledo will head to Charlottesville, Va. to compete in Virginia's Lewis Chitengwa Memorial on Monday and Tuesday before heading to Bloomington, Ind. for the Hoosier Collegiate Invitational on Saturday and Sunday. Following these tournaments, UT will begin preparation for the MAC Championships on May 3-5. Senior Bence Kotel is leading the Rockets with a 72.1 stroke average.
BASEBALL
Tuesday, April 14 / vs. Michigan / Fifth Third Field / 6:30 p.m. / Tickets / Watch (BCSN/ESPN+) / Live Stats
Friday, April 17 / vs. Miami / Scott Park / 3:00 p.m. / Watch (ESPN+) / Live Stats
Saturday, April 18 / vs. Miami / Scott Park / 1:00 p.m. / Watch (ESPN+) / Live Stats
Sunday, April 19 / vs. Miami / Scott Park / 1:00 p.m. / Watch (ESPN+) / Live Stats
Baseball heads home this week for four games in the Glass City. The Rockets first take on Michigan on Tuesday, April 14 downtown at Fifth Third Field, home of the Toledo Mud Hens. First pitch is at 6:30 p.m. on BCSN and ESPN+, and tickets can be found at UTRockets.com/tickets. The Rockets then head to Scott Park for another key Mid-American Conference series on Friday-Sunday, taking on Miami in a battle of second-place teams. Game times for the weekend are 3:00, 1:00 and 1:00 with streaming on ESPN+. Toledo (16-19, 12-6 MAC) dropped 2-of-3 at Western Michigan last week. On Friday, Nathan Leininger continued his dominant season on the mound, pitching seven shutout innings in a 3-2 win. UT is in a five-way tie for second place in the MAC standings, one game behind Kent State for first place.
WOMEN'S TRACK & FIELD
Thursday-Saturday, April 16-18 / at 55th Annual GINA Relays / Hillsdale, Mich.
Thursday-Saturday, April 16-18 / at Wake Forest Invitational / Winston-Salem, N.C.
Track & Field continues outdoor action at a pair of meets this weekend, the 55th Annual GINA Relays in Hillsdale, Mich. and the Wake Forest Invitational in Winston-Salem, N.C. Last time out, the team split between the Duke Invitational and the We Fly Challenge. Freshman Sydney Stepanovich took fifth overall in the 400m, and the men's distance team competed at Duke. Max Matolin took fourth in the 3000m steeplechase as Sibonelo Khumalo led the team in the 5000m with a seventh-place finish.
WOMEN'S GOLF
Friday-Saturday, April 17-18 / at Therese Hession Buckeye Invitational / Columbus, Ohio / Live Scoring
Women's Golf receives its final tuneup prior to the MAC Championships on April 26-28 when it travels to Columbus, Ohio for the Therese Hession Buckeye Invitational. The tournament will be held at the OSU Scarlet Course. Sophomore Brooklyn Millard is leading the Rockets with a 76.6 stroke average.
SOFTBALL
Friday, April 17 / at Western Michigan / Kalamazoo, Mich. / 3:00 p.m. / Watch / Live Stats
Saturday, April 18 / at Western Michigan / Kalamazoo, Mich. / 1:00 p.m. (DH) / Watch / Live Stats
Saturday, April 18 / at Western Michigan / Kalamazoo, Mich. / 3:00 p.m. (DH) / Watch / Live Stats
Softball returns to action with a pivotal three-game conference series against Western Michigan in Kalamazoo, Mich. this weekend. The Rockets earned a series win over Bowling Green in the Battle of I-75 last week before falling to Miami at home over the weekend. Freshman Aubrey Hensley led the offense last week, batting .429 with six hits, including a double. Samantha Bolding continues to lead the team offensively with a .373 average at the plate and a team-high 34 runs scored.
WOMEN'S ROWING
Saturday-Sunday, April 18-19 / at SIRA Championship Regatta / Oak Ridge, Tenn. / 11:00 a.m.
Rowing continues spring action at the SIRA Championship Regatta in Oak Ridge, Tenn. this weekend. The Rockets began spring competition at the Lubbers Cup on April 4 with the Varsity 4+ boat taking first in the B final.Â
WOMEN'S TENNIS
Sunday, April 19 / at Bowling Green / Bowling Green, Ohio / 1:00 p.m. / Watch (BCSN/ESPN+)
Women's Tennis wraps up the regular season with the Battle of I-75 match, presented by Fremont Federal Credit Union on Sunday at 1:00 p.m. The Rockets clinched a spot in the 2026 MAC Tournament by posting a 4-3 win over Ball State on Friday and handing UMass its first conference loss of the season with a 5-2 victory on Sunday. Sophomore Annika Munson clinched match point against the Cardinals with a straight-set win on the No. 6 singles court. Against the Minutewomen, freshman Isabella Barretto clinched the victory with a 7-5, 7-5 win on the No. 1 singles court.Â
